FYNNLAND Football Club has started with its preparations for the 2015 soccer season.

After a successful 2014 season, players and coaches have a tough act to follow and are going to be pushed to their limits to achieve the same high standards. There is no doubt that they will succeed and that the 2015 season will be more successful and will see the club grow in strength and numbers.

The Fynnland senior sides have already started training. They train on Mondays and Thursdays from 6.30pm to 8pm. Until now, the turnout at training has been excellent and bodes well for the forthcoming season. The club welcomes new players and anyone interested in trying out for the teams are invited to attend training. This season the senior teams will be under the leadership and guidance of Jonathan Cauvin, Billy Laidlaw and Gary Herbert.
